French revolution, revolutionary movement that shook france between 1787 and 1799 and reached its first climax there in 1789hence the conventional term revolution of 1789, denoting the end of the ancien regime in france and serving also to distinguish that event from the later french revolutions of 1830 and 1848. The absolute monarchy that had ruled france for centuries collapsed in three years. The french revolution and the concept of nation and liberty essay 914 words 4 pages the french revolution occurred between the years 1789 and 1799 and it was characterized by a period of radical political and social upheavals, whose impacts were felt both in france and the entire continent of europe.
